Capsule History of Sundance Cattle Company

Sundance Cattle Company was the brainchild of an informal gathering of friends that met starting around 1975 at the Barn
to play pool.  Over time, this group of people decided it was they wanted to start a legacy, so they founded Sundance in 1980
with their home bar being the Barn.  Houston GLBT Hall-of-Famer Marion Coleman was one of the most prominent
members of the club from during this time.

Later in time, the club would move its colors to Cousins, but little remains from this period in history as well.

Then, came the famous years at Mary's of which many fond memories remain for many of our honorary members plus the
paper trail tells of our many anniversary events there that were attended by some current Houston organizations,
out-of-town clubs, and defunct groups such as the Texas Riders or the Rainbow Wranglers.  Golden Eras of the club
happened at Mary's and saw such greats as Lady Victoria Lust, Eartha Quake, and Fanny Farmer be very active helping out
the community.

On Leap Day in 2008, Sundance Cattle Company moved its colors to George's Country Sports Bar in a celebration that
brought together a diverse crowd from the community, including representatives from many of the area organizations and
even more individuals.  The first LUEY at George's occurred in 2009 which kicked off the club's comeback into the
community after a rough period that followed Hurricane Ike.

Due to our major growth between LUEY 2009 and 2010, we needed to find a bigger space in which to hold our meetings and
events.  As a result, the club voted overwhelmingly at its meeting on March 5, 2010, to move its colors to EJ's, which truly
draws people from all walks of life in addition to having a big patio, a good stage and sound system, and a margarita bar!  
Most importantly, EJ's can accommodate the big crowds that help make community events grand.

At the very same historic meeting on March 5, 2010, Sundance gained its first honorary member in several years as
reigning Member of the Year Rome Rivera got the requisite unanimous vote!
